What Is Traditional Exfoliation?

Traditional exfoliation refers to methods that remove dead skin using either physical or chemical techniques. Physical exfoliation includes scrubs, brushes, and microbeads, while chemical exfoliation relies on acids like AHAs, BHAs, and enzymes. These methods work by dissolving or lifting dead skin cells from the surface. Although helpful, they come with limitations, and this is where the Dermaplane Facial stands out.

What Is a Dermaplane Facial?

A Dermaplane Facial is a professional treatment that uses a sterile surgical scalpel to gently remove dead skin cells and fine vellus hair (peach fuzz). This manual exfoliation technique instantly reveals smoother, brighter skin. Because it removes both debris and tiny facial hairs, the Dermaplane Facial provides a unique level of refinement that traditional exfoliation methods cannot typically match.

Key Difference #1: Level of Exfoliation

Traditional exfoliation offers mild to moderate resurfacing depending on the product used. Scrubs provide surface-level results, while chemical acids penetrate deeper layers.
In comparison, the Dermaplane Facial delivers a precise and controlled exfoliation, removing more accumulated debris than most home or spa exfoliants. The blade allows for uniform resurfacing across the entire face, making the Dermaplane Facial one of the most effective non-chemical exfoliation options available.

Key Difference #2: Removal of Peach Fuzz

One major advantage of the Dermaplane Facial is its ability to remove peach fuzz. Traditional exfoliation methods do not remove vellus hair. By eliminating this fine hair, the Dermaplane Facial helps makeup apply more smoothly, prevents buildup, and enhances overall skin clarity.

Key Difference #3: Suitability for Sensitive Skin

Many traditional exfoliation products—especially physical scrubs—can irritate sensitive or acne-prone skin. Harsh granules may cause micro-tears or inflammation.
A Dermaplane Facial, when performed by a trained professional, is gentle and safe for most skin types, including those with sensitivity. It avoids harsh chemicals and abrasive particles while still producing powerful exfoliating results.

Key Difference #4: Instant Results

Although traditional exfoliation can improve skin texture over time, results are often gradual. With a Dermaplane Facial, the improvement is immediate. Clients leave with smoother, brighter skin after just one session. This instant gratification is a key reason why the Dermaplane Facial is so popular at modern wellness and aesthetic clinics.

Key Difference #5: Product Absorption

Traditional exfoliation improves product absorption by removing some dead skin, but the Dermaplane Facial optimizes this benefit by clearing away a deeper layer of buildup. After a Dermaplane Facial, serums and moisturizers penetrate more effectively, making any post-treatment skincare regimen significantly more impactful.

Key Difference #6: Safety and Professional Skill

Traditional exfoliation can be done at home, but that convenience also increases the risk of over-exfoliation. Too many scrubs, brushes, or acids can damage the skin barrier.

Key Difference #7: Anti-Aging Benefits

Traditional exfoliation softens fine lines over time but often cannot reach deeper layers. The Dermaplane Facial removes compacted dead cells, allowing collagen-boosting skincare products to work more effectively. Regular Dermaplane Facial treatments can help reduce the appearance of fine lines, uneven texture, and dullness.

Who Should Choose a Dermaplane Facial?

A Dermaplane Facial is ideal for anyone looking for:

  • Smoother skin texture
  • Immediate brightening
  • Better makeup application
  • Removal of peach fuzz
  • Enhanced product absorption
  • A gentle, non-chemical exfoliation

If you have active acne, a Dermaplane Facial may be postponed until inflammation subsides, but it is excellent for most other skin types.

Who Should Choose Traditional Exfoliation?

Traditional exfoliation is still valuable, especially for those who prefer at-home skincare or want mild weekly resurfacing. Chemical exfoliation with AHAs or BHAs can also target specific concerns like clogged pores or hyperpigmentation. However, these methods complement—rather than replace—the benefits of a Dermaplane Facial.
